Refugee - the Refugeless
Refugee - the refugeless!
Belonged somewhere sometime,
to relate with, in space and time;
Uprooted, evicted or torn asunder,
circumstances induced mindless plunder!
Giving up all that once belonged,
alien and distant shores we thronged!
Dangers abound on the ruthless trip,
false promises made to safely ship!
Causes aplenty for me, to set-off,
on journey - any human would scoff!
My body ain't mine, till I reach,
my life at mercy of a blood sucking leech!
No tears to shed or a way to tread,
wandered in seas and land for bread.
Befriended death, 'the trustworthy',
who often checked, if I was 'seaworthy'!
Wet and tired from within too - my state,
at an alien shore, extended souls berate!
Herded at their will, coerced to spill,
tired of being treated like cattle!
Some of me was just a few months old
and was expected to do just as I was told!
In this measurable space in which I roll,
Life loses to life and Soul loses out to soul!
